Byrna Technologies Inc. (NASDAQ: BYRN) Insider Boosts Stake Amidst Leadership Changes and Mixed Q1 Results

An insider at Byrna Technologies, a company specializing in less-lethal personal security devices, has increased their stake. On April 15, 2026, Ganz Bryan purchased 1,500 shares at $6.56 each. This transaction brings Bryan's total ownership in the company to 382,673 shares, signaling confidence amidst several key company developments.

This insider activity occurs as Byrna Technologies undergoes leadership changes. As highlighted by GlobeNewswire, the company appointed Conn Davis as its new Chief Executive Officer, taking over from the retiring CEO, Bryan Ganz. Additionally, Byrna Technologies promoted Matthew Campagni to the role of Chief Strategy Officer to help guide its future growth.

Financially, the company presents a mixed first-quarter report. Byrna Technologies announced earnings of $0.03 per share, which is the profit divided among all company shares. This figure missed the Zacks Consensus Estimate of $0.05 per share. It also marks a decrease from the $0.07 per share reported in the same quarter last year.

However, the company's revenue, or total sales, for the quarter was approximately $29.05 million, which exceeded analyst expectations. This revenue figure is an increase from the $26.19 million generated in the same period a year ago. This suggests that while profitability per share is down, overall sales are growing.

Operationally, Byrna Technologies is expanding its retail presence. The company has started a new partnership with Academy Sports + Outdoors, launching in about 50 stores. It plans to expand to between 200 and 250 stores by year-end. This move increases the company's footprint in Texas and the Southeast U.S.
